  • Opened this bottle with not a little trepidation...
    Given the history with premox, we were prepared for the worst and already had an alternative wine ready.
    However, there was no premox at all in this bottle. The cork, while almost soaked hrough, had done its job.
    The hue was perfectly acceptable for a 24 year old Chardonnay with a light golden aspect.
    The aromas confirmed that this bottle had not suffered: great purity and intensity of aromas all supported by a very solid acid backbone providing freshness. The aromas were ranging from citrus to orange blossoms with just a whiff of butter and a saline, mineral streak as well. Beautiful texture providing roundness, focus, length all at the same time.
    I plan to drink remaining bottles over next couple of years.

  • Medium gold in color. Forward and attractive nose with floral overtones of honeysuckle & jasmine, some butterscotch, citric notes of lemon & lime with stony and mineral undertones. Well balanced with well developed ripe fruit flavors of Myer lemon, lime, some grapefruit, honey, lychee, with stone & minerals. A long lingering & crisp finish.

  • As per my unfortunate history with this producer, this wine is oxidized. Thank God, this is my last bottle of 96 Morgeot. I have 2 remaining Remilly to take a chance on, but I certainly would not put actual money on that bet.

    What a dissapointment Colin-Deleger has been to me since 95, 96, 99, 00. I have learned my lesson- big time.
